Using Terraform with Google Cloud - Creating and Managing Virtual Machines
Offered By: HashiCorp via YouTube
Course Description
Overview
Learn how to create a Virtual Machine in Google Cloud using Terraform in this comprehensive video tutorial. Discover the process of provisioning an application with cloud init scripts, leveraging data sources and variables for dynamic configuration, and utilizing outputs to retrieve details of created resources. Follow along as the instructor demonstrates adding providers, authenticating the Google Cloud Provider, creating Virtual Machine resources, and using data sources. Gain hands-on experience with Terraform commands such as init, plan, apply, and destroy. Explore advanced topics including Terraform functions, updating resources, and working with complex variables and conditional statements. By the end of this 1 hour 17 minute tutorial, you'll have a solid foundation in using Terraform with Google Cloud for infrastructure automation.
